## Build Provenance: Fare Trials Experiment

Welcome aboard. Every artifact in the Merrowgate ticket-pricing experiment must be traceable to a signed build. Before touching experiment configs, confirm the deployed binary matches the provenance record: check the attestation in the release manifest, verify the signer is the Merrowgate pipeline key, and confirm the source ref matches the approved experiment branch. Never run pricing variants from locally built artifacts. The current approved build for the fare trials is listed below.

pipeline stamp: htk6_c0ef30

Hey plugin authors — welcome to the ContrastKeeper audit pipeline. Your plugin gets called once per page with the computed palette; return WCAG ratios and we handle the report. Run `ck-audit --local` to test against the Fernwick sample site. Plugins run sandboxed, so file access is read-only except /tmp. Config comes from .env in your plugin root; copy .env.example first and fill in the scan depth and locale. The hosted report API needs an auth token to accept uploads. Put that token on the next line.

env line for fafof-fahag: LEDGER_TOKEN5=f8790

Ticket: Staging env misconfigured for Siftgate bloom filter

The bloom layer in front of the Pellet KV store is rejecting all lookups in staging because the env file was copied from the dev template without credentials. False-positive tuning values are fine; only the auth line is missing. To unblock the weekly demo, the Pellet admission secret must be set on the following line.

env line for yaguf-fajop: LEDGER_TOKEN13=fb08984397349

Migration step 4 — Monthly partitioning (Pellwick Analytics)

For this week's sync: we partition the events table by calendar month starting with the March cut. Backfill runs oldest-first, one partition per job, so expect roughly two days of elevated I/O. Queries against unpartitioned replicas keep working during the transition. The partition manager is driven entirely by service configuration, reproduced here for review.

deployment values, yadup-kadug:
[sorys]
port = 5672
team = noveth
host = sorys.orvexcorp.example
region = south-4
access_code = ac_deddc1
timeout_ms = 1500